2008 ICD-9-CM Diagnosis 996.63

Infection and inflammatory reaction due to nervous system device implant and graft

996.63 also known as:

  • Electrodes implanted in brain
  • Peripheral nerve graft
  • Spinal canal catheter
  • Ventricular (communicating) shunt (catheter)
